Minnesota Twins Defeat Philadelphia Phillies 5-0 to Clinch Home-Field Advantage for Brewers

The Minnesota Twins dominated the Philadelphia Phillies with a 5-0 victory on Saturday night, highlighted by an impressive pitching performance from Mick Abel. This shutout allowed the Milwaukee Brewers to secure home-field advantage throughout the postseason.

Mick Abel Shines Against Former Team

Mick Abel, making his first start against the team that drafted him, struck out nine batters and pitched six scoreless innings. Abel (3-4) allowed only three hits and one walk, displaying control and poise on the mound. Abel was acquired by Minnesota from Philadelphia in July as part of the deal for closer Jhoan Duran.

Offensive Firepower from Buxton, Outman, and Fitzgerald

Byron Buxton set the pace early with a leadoff home run against Phillies starter Ranger Suárez. This marked Buxton’s 20th career leadoff homer and his 11th of the season, tying the Twins' franchise record previously set by Jacque Jones in 2002.

James Outman added another home run off Suárez, while Ryan Fitzgerald hit a solo shot off Phillies reliever Max Lazar. Ryan Jeffers chipped in with an RBI double to extend Minnesota’s lead.

Philadelphia Locks in No. 2 Seed

Starting pitcher Ranger Suárez (12-8) lasted 4 1/3 innings, allowing three runs on nine hits for the Phillies. The loss confirmed Philadelphia's position as the No. 2 seed in the National League playoffs. Although the Phillies could still match Milwaukee’s win total, the Brewers own the tiebreaker for home-field advantage.

Key Moment: Suárez Injured by Line Drive

One of the game’s pivotal moments occurred when Ryan Jeffers hit a scorching 106 mph line drive that struck Suárez on the inside of his left thigh. The Phillies starter was doubled over in pain while attempting to throw out Jeffers at first base. He was removed from the game due to a contusion and will be reevaluated.

Key Stat: Abel’s Consistency

Mick Abel has shown remarkable consistency against Major League hitters. He previously made his debut with the Phillies on May 18, pitching six scoreless innings with nine strikeouts, outdueling Pirates right-hander Paul Skenes in that outing.

Up Next

The regular season finale will feature Twins right-hander Simeon Woods Richardson (7-4, 4.27 ERA) facing Phillies left-hander Cristopher Sánchez (13-5, 2.57 ERA).
